Yes clans are FOR PvP. But PvP is to broad. There is no logical reason why a lvl 5,000 can attack a lvl 50 even if clans are specifically for PvP. The problem the OP is having is battles are over in a split second meaning a much MUCH more powerful player killed him while he was typing.
If a PvP buffer zone was emplamented it would take longer for him to die. If you can only PvP players with a lvl 50% higher or 50% lower than you, than the battle would last long enough for you to get done typing and react.

50% either way would mean a lvl 2000 could attack anyone 1,000 to 3,000. Or a lvl 100 could attack anyone lvl 50 to 150.

On clan building maps this could be increased to 75% either way.

This would end the illogical and unfair tactics that super high lvls use against new players who join a clan more for the help/communication aspect that clans provide. And even the playing field that a lvl100 who actually wants to PvP but can't because there's always a lvl2,000 waiting to kill him.

You know how to use the /msg command right?

/msg username82 hi username82. How do you do today?
That is the format.
/msg.space.username.space.your message
(without the dots)
Then you will see potential enemies coming as you are tyoing your message because there is nothing covering the screen...problem solved.
Also, you should check on your ft app info page (where it gives you the option to force close/uninstall app) to make sure that notifications are turned on. If they are turned off on this screen, You won't get a noticlfication when you are attacked, simple as that.

Now might be a good time to remind people of the whisper command too.

/w username82 hi username 82, how do you do.
This is the same (green text) as pressing someone's speach bubble but you can be the other side of the same map to do it, also, you don't need to be on their friends list to do it.
